85.37 percent of the population in 33621 drive to work alone. 0.00 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 93.13 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 2.77 percent of the residents in 33621 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 4.25 members with about 2.15 cars available per household.
An estimate of 67.14 percent of the residents in 33621 has some form of health insurance. 4.04 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 64.49 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 33621 would have to travel an average of 2.76 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Hca Florida South Tampa Hospital . In a 20-mile radius, there are 0 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 33621, Tampa, Florida.

As of , an estimate of 2,599 residents live in 33621 with a median age of 21.6 years. 36.67 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 0.00 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 39.86 percent of the residents in 33621 is currently married, and 31.19 percent of the population has never been married.
The monthly median household income in 33621 is $6,815.50.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 33621 is approximately $2,349. The median household spends about 34.47 percent of their income on housing.

Type 1 Diabetes is a chronic condition in which the pancreas produces little or no insulin, a hormone essential for allowing sugar (glucose) to enter cells and produce energy. This condition requires ongoing management and regular medical attention, making access to healthcare providers vital for those living with Type 1 Diabetes.
The financial cost of missing a provider's appointment can be significant for individuals with Type 1 Diabetes. Without proper care and monitoring, they are at risk of developing complications that can lead to hospitalization or other serious health issues. Therefore, having easy access to healthcare services is essential for individuals managing this condition.
